Who we are:
American Innovations protects people and the environment by providing proven compliance solutions to oil and gas professionals from the field to the office. More than 30 years of experience drives innovative solutions that address the need for efficient data collection, reporting, and analysis – an integrated family of hardware, software and professional services backed by relentless customer service.  


We are seeking a skilled and hands-on Mid-Level Hardware Engineer to join our Engineering team. This role will be responsible for the design, validation, and support of analog and mixed-signal electronics used in field-deployed industrial systems. The ideal candidate brings a strong foundation in analog circuit design, enjoys solving real-world engineering challenges, and is comfortable supporting products throughout their entire lifecycle—from concept and development through manufacturing and field support.


In addition to hardware design responsibilities, this position plays an important role in product lifecycle management by maintaining engineering documentation, managing bills of materials, supporting engineering change processes, and helping ensure continuity between engineering and manufacturing operations. The successful candidate will thrive in a collaborative environment and work closely with firmware, mechanical, manufacturing, and product teams to deliver reliable, cost-effective solutions that support our customers' critical operations. 


Primary Responsibilities
  • Analog and mixed-signal hardware design for field-deployed electronics
  • Schematic design, component selection, and design validation
  • Production support, failure analysis, and field issue resolution
  • Cost reduction initiatives and alternate vendor qualification
Secondary Responsibilities (Arena / PLM)
  • Create and release electronics BOMs in Arena
  • Maintain approved vendor lists (AVL)
  • Execute ECOs related to electrical changes
  • Serve as backup for BOM release during peak loads or absences

Requirements

 

Key Qualifications

  • 4–7 years of hardware design experience
  • Strong analog design background (signal conditioning, power, sensing)
  • Experience with field-deployed or industrial electronics
  • Familiarity with manufacturing support and lifecycle management
  • Experience with PLM systems (Arena preferred)

Nice to Have

  • Exposure to cathodic protection, measurement, or industrial monitoring systems
  • Experience with EOL mitigation and alternate sourcing
  • Comfort working cross-functionally with mechanical, firmware, and manufacturing teams
